Renewable energy sources are essential for meeting global energy needs while reducing environmental impacts. This study introduces an integrated neutrosophic DEMATEL-ANP-VIKOR approach to evaluate and prioritize renewable energy sources based on various criteria, providing a comprehensive and systematic decision-making framework. The approach leverages DEMATEL to identify and analyze causal relationships between criteria, offering valuable insights into the interdependencies and influence of each factor. ANP is then employed to calculate the relative importance of these criteria, accounting for the complex interrelations that often exist in multi-criteria problems. Finally, VIKOR is utilized to rank the alternatives by balancing conflicting criteria and highlighting the most optimal renewable energy source alternatives. By incorporating neutrosophic numbers, the approach effectively addresses the uncertainty, vagueness, and imprecision commonly encountered in expert judgments, ensuring more reliable and robust evaluations. This integrated methodology not only enhances the accuracy and consistency of the decision-making process but also provides decision-makers with a flexible tool adaptable to varying contexts and priorities in renewable energy investments.
